Poindexter Coffee, located at 11 Dorrance St, Providence, RI, is a delightful café known for its warm atmosphere and exceptional service. This charming spot offers an inviting space with cozy seating and carefully crafted beverages from locally roasted beans by Counter Culture. Patrons rave about the delicious French toast sticks and avocado toast, alongside delightful pastries like the banana nut muffin. With friendly baristas like Leah and Stephen, customers feel valued and welcomed. The café blends great food with a rich ambiance, making it a must-visit destination for coffee lovers and breakfast enthusiasts alike.
